This Earthlearningidea activity, "Laying Out the Rock Cycle: Product and Process," engages students in arranging rock-cycle products such as sediment, soil, hand-specimen rocks, and images on a large rock-cycle diagram, then connecting them with labeled Earth processes like weathering, erosion, deposition, metamorphism, melting, and uplift. The lesson begins with small group activities and expands into a whole-class, room-sized version to reinforce spatial and conceptual understanding. Students gain a clearer grasp of how Earth processes create specific rock materials and learn to distinguish between rapid and long-term changes in the rock cycle. The activity also addresses common misconceptions, such as the belief that squashing sediments forms rock, and includes printable materials like rock flashcards, process labels, and rock specimens to support hands-on learning.

The "Hands-On Rock Cycle: Crayons & Cookies" activity from Our Journey Westward offers an engaging and tactile approach to teaching the rock cycle, ideal for upper elementary and middle school students. Using everyday materials like crayons and aluminum foil, students simulate the formation of sedimentary, metamorphic, and igneous rocks by applying pressure and heat to crayon shavings. This creative method allows learners to observe the physical changes that mimic natural geological processes. The activity also includes an edible extension where students create treats representing each rock type, such as layered bars for sedimentary rocks, cookies for metamorphic rocks, and fudge for igneous rocks, making abstract concepts more concrete and memorable.

Guide students through an edible rock cycle lab where they create models of each rock type using treats. Layered snacks, such as cereal bars, represent sedimentary rocks, while pressed or swirled cookie dough simulates metamorphic rocks, and melted and cooled fudge acts as igneous rock. Students can participate in a rock cycle role-play game, where they assume the role of particles moving through various Earth processes. Stations are set up around the room to represent multiple locations, including volcanoes, oceans, and mountains. Have students use crayons for a rock cycle simulation, where they use crayon shavings to model the formation of rocks. By layering and pressing the shavings, they simulate the formation of sedimentary rocks. Applying heat and pressure mimics the formation of metamorphic rocks, and melting and cooling the crayons demonstrates how igneous rocks form.

The Environmental Movement and the First Earth Day provides educators with a concise video overview of the origins of the environmental movement and the inaugural Earth Day in 1970. The video highlights the increasing public awareness of environmental issues during the 1960s, influenced by events such as the publication of Rachel Carson's "Silent Spring" and significant pollution incidents. It also discusses the pivotal role of activists and policymakers in establishing Earth Day, which mobilized millions and led to the creation of key environmental legislation and organizations.

PBS LearningMedia's Mechanisms of Plate Movement explores the different types of tectonic plate boundaries. This media gallery includes an interactive gallery and animations of plate processes from NOVA. The resources include: Mountain Maker, Earth Shaker, Divergent Boundary, Converging Boundary (Oceanic-Continental), Converging Boundary (Continental-Continental), and Transform Boundary. Each of the boundary resources includes a short video. The site also provides supporting materials for teachers (teaching tips and background reading) and students (discussion questions and assignments). Everything in the collection can be shared via Google Classroom, a link to students, and social sharing. The lessons cover the NGSS Standards.
